Course Content

• Advanced Text Mining and Analytics
• Information Retrieval Systems & Evaluation
• Textual Data Preprocessing & Cleaning
• Indexing Structures and Algorithms (Inverted Index, Suffix Trees)
• Search Engine Optimization (SEO) and Keyword Extraction
• Machine Learning for Textual Data Indexing
• Metadata and Ontology Design for Textual Data
• Ethical Considerations in Textual Data Management

Career path

Career Role Description Skills
Data Scientist (Textual Data Focus) Develops and implements machine learning models for textual data analysis, leveraging advanced indexing techniques. High demand in various sectors. Python, R, NLP, Text Mining, Indexing Algorithms, Database Management
Information Retrieval Specialist Designs and optimizes systems for efficient textual data retrieval and indexing. Crucial for effective search engines and knowledge management. Information Retrieval Models, Search Engine Optimization (SEO), Indexing Strategies, Data Structures, Database Systems
Text Analytics Consultant Provides expert advice on textual data analysis and indexing strategies for businesses. Translates complex findings into actionable insights. Text Analytics, Business Intelligence, Consulting, Data Visualization, Communication Skills
Natural Language Processing (NLP) Engineer Develops and improves NLP models, contributing to advanced indexing and text understanding capabilities. Focus on algorithm design and optimization. NLP Algorithms, Deep Learning, Machine Learning, Python, Java, Software Engineering
